Most modern laptops no longer use LVDS for connecting the screen, but they use eDP (embedded DisplayPort).
So LVDS is more likely to linger in automotive displays, while in less obsolete devices it has been replaced by either eDP or by MIPI DSI (used e.g. in smartphones).
